CorrelationDataMessageProperty Klasa

Definicja

Udostępnia właściwość komunikatu, która gromadzi dodatkowe informacje o korelacji dla komunikatu w czasie stosowania protokołów, na przykład gdy dane są zwracane z komunikatu MessageQuerySet przychodzącego.

public ref class CorrelationDataMessageProperty : System::ServiceModel::Channels::IMessageProperty
public class CorrelationDataMessageProperty : System.ServiceModel.Channels.IMessageProperty
type CorrelationDataMessageProperty = class
    interface IMessageProperty
Public Class CorrelationDataMessageProperty
Implements IMessageProperty
Dziedziczenie
CorrelationDataMessageProperty
Implementuje

Uwagi

Dane korelacji skumulowane przez klasy rozszerzają zawartość komunikatu podczas obliczania kluczy CorrelationDataMessageProperty wystąpienia, które wiążą komunikaty z innymi komunikatami.

Konstruktory

CorrelationDataMessageProperty()

Inicjuje nowe wystąpienie klasy CorrelationDataMessageProperty.

Właściwości

Name

Pobiera nazwę tej właściwości komunikatu: "CorrelationDataMessageProperty".

Metody

Add(String, Func<String>)

Dodaje dostawcę danych korelacji do prywatnego słownika dostawców właściwości.

AddData(Message, String, Func<String>)

Dodaje dane korelacji do określonego komunikatu.

CreateCopy()

Inicjuje i zwraca nowe CorrelationDataMessageProperty wystąpienie, które jest kopią bieżącego CorrelationDataMessageProperty wystąpienia.

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Type Pobiera wartość bieżącego wystąpienia.

(Odziedziczone po Object)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Objectelementu .

(Odziedziczone po Object)
Remove(String)

Usuwa dostawcę danych korelacji z prywatnego słownika dostawców danych.

ToString()

Zwraca ciąg reprezentujący bieżący obiekt.

(Odziedziczone po Object)
TryGet(Message, CorrelationDataMessageProperty)

Próbuje pobrać z CorrelationDataMessageProperty określonego komunikatu Properties .

TryGet(MessageProperties, CorrelationDataMessageProperty)

Próbuje pobrać z CorrelationDataMessageProperty określonych właściwości komunikatu.

TryGetValue(String, String)

Próbuje pobrać określonego dostawcę danych korelacji z prywatnego słownika dostawców danych.

Dotyczy